Huck * DATE : Nov 2018 Module Summary ############### Tools for gpu and cuda operations Module Contents --------------- Functions ~~~~~~~~~ .. autoapisummary:: python.odpy.gpuinfo.is_cuda_available python.odpy.gpuinfo.detect_gpus python.odpy.gpuinfo.nr_gpus python.odpy.gpuinfo.compute_capability python.odpy.gpuinfo.id python.odpy.gpuinfo.name python.odpy.gpuinfo.get_memory_info .. py:function:: is_cuda_available() Checks if cuda device is available Returns: * bool: True if cuda is available, False if otherwise .. py:function:: detect_gpus(printfn=print) Displays cuda devices available Notes: Information on device type, id, compute type and capacity are displayed >>> import odpy.gpuinfo as gpuinfo >>> gpuinfo.detect_gpus() Found 1 CUDA devices id 0 b'NVIDIA GeForce MX250' [SUPPORTED] compute capability: 6.1 pci device id: 0 pci bus id: 2 .. py:function:: nr_gpus() Counts number of gpu devices Returns: int: number of gpu devices available for computations .. py:function:: compute_capability(devnum=0) Compute capacity of cuda device Parameters: * devnum (int): cuda device id, defaults to 0 Returns: * tuple: compute capacity level of cuda device >>> import odpy.gpuinfo as gpuinfo >>> gpuinfo.compute_capability(0) (6, 1) .. py:function:: id(devnum=0) Gets cuda device id Parameters: * devnum (int): cuda device number, defaults to 0 Returns: * int: cuda device id .. py:function:: name(devnum=0) Gets cuda device name Parameters: * devnum (int): cuda device number, defaults to 0 Returns: * str: cuda device name .. py:function:: get_memory_info(devnum=None) Gets memory info of cuda device Parameters: * devnum (int): cuda device number, defaults to None Returns: * obj: Memory info Example >>> import odpy.gpuinfo as gpuinfo >>> gpuinfo.get_memory_info() MemoryInfo(free=1742539571, total=2147483648)
